This is the current, confirmed item list. It contains all of the game's upgrades and expansions. It is subject to change at any time. This is list as of...
7/7/2011

Beams.



1. Power Beam.
- This is the beam that you start the game with. Utilizes a very high rate of fire and causes a typical, moderately concussive force upon impact. However, it's lack of accuracy and power do not allow you to protect yourself in the stickiest of situations.
Special Abilities: (None).

2. Wave Beam.
- This beam combines highly-concentrated electrical energy with dimensional-phasing capabilities to allow it to pass through most walls. It has far greater power than the Power Beam but the range is short and the rate of fire is nothing to scream about.
Special Abilities: Wall-piercing, effective vs. Mech and Cyborg enemy types.

3. Plasma Beam.
- The Plasma Beam is held in high regard amongst it's Chozo creators. The new generation of "Plasma" beam had advanced from it's proton-based predecessor. The creators decided that they could use super-heated gases to not only create a very effective weapon, but be used for welding and melting obstructions. It is a powerful beam with phenomenal range, versatility, accuracy, and fire rate but does not come without a major setback. This is the overheating issue. Luckily, Samus' Power Suit allows for a built-in intercooling system. You will be unable to switch weapons or fire while overheated.
Special Abilities: Overheating, melt Pardesium obstructions, effective against Ice enemy type.

4. Spazer Beam.
- Spazer Beams were used by many of the front-line units of the Chozo militia. They were made for two things - clearing rooms of massive amounts of weak targets, and replacing the prototype failure, the Spread Cannon. The improvement was more than significant when they implemented the Spazer Beam with three barrels, allowing the "beam" to split into three. Thus, the area it covers is great. As for its other attributes, it is simply average.
Special Ability: Multiple projectiles.

5. Pulse Beam.
- The Pulse Beam was a major project in development by the Galactic Federation. The plan was to replace the subpar G.F. rifles currently being utilized by Federation Troopers. They planned to increase the accuracy by aiding the user in controlling their weapon. What resulted was the prototype Pulse Beam. It fires in three-shot bursts with great speed, accuracy, and range. The purpose was to make it easier to defeat an enemy with a regenerative suit. Most regenerative suits take one to two seconds after taking damage to gather an electronic "damage report" before actually regenerating. The Pulse Beam's extreme speed allows to keep resetting the timer, making regeneration impossible. Most notably, rogue Chozo with stolen technology were the bearers of regenerative gear.
Special Abilities: Burst-fire, high accuracy.

6. Ice Beam.
- A classic weapon used by the Chozo warriors, the Ice Beam is feared by Metroids and Space Pirates alike. The subzero beam utilizes super-concentrated, projectile liquid nitrogen which pierces enemies to the core, freezing them into solid ice for a short time. Many enemies can be shattered after being frozen with a concussive blast from a Chozo Missile.
Special Abilities: Freezing, effective against Metroid enemy types.

7. Nova Beam.
- Nova Beams were invented by the notorious Space Pirates as a prototype weapon for piercing Phazite. Very few of them made it into the hands of Pirate soldiers, as the prototype beams never left their homeworld of Urtragia. The unique ability of the beam by itself is the incredibly fast recharge rate. This means that the user can fire the beam as fast as they can pull the trigger. The Nova Beam utilizes amazing power, range, accuracy, and if the user permits it, speed.
Special Ability: Unlimited speed.

8. Dark Beam.
- The Dark Beam is one of three legendary Luminoth weapons that they used to fight the Ing in their war with Dark Aether. The beam has since been modified to release semi-sentient darklings that detect and destroy any nearby enemies by ramming into them and exploding. It has moderate power, speed, and accuracy, and is great for clearing rooms with lots of weak enemies.
Special Abilities: Releases Darklings on impact that seek enemies, effective against Organic and Light enemy types.

9. Light Beam.
- When the idea of overloading dark enemies with dark energy was rendered useless, the Light Beam was born. It is truly a testament to the Luminoths inherently vast knowledge gained from the Chozo. The beam utterly destroys enemies with dark-based powers and defenses. The impact of the projectile creates a vast, blinding burst of light, damaging anything inside it. It has amazing power, decent range, great accuracy, but somewhat slow speed.
Special Abilities: High power, explosion damages enemies, effective against Dark enemy types.

10. Phazon Beam. - This is the ultimate beam. Phazon, being the most radioactive and mutagenic substance in the universe, is used in a way never conceived before. While requiring Phazon to actually operate, the beam combines many of the incredible features of other beams, making it totally unmatched. It has the speed and range of the Nova Beam, twice the power of the Plasma Beam, the accuracy of the Pulse Beam, and the ability to cut through enemies of all types. Only a powerful suit with Phazon-assimilation powers could fuel the Phazon Beam with the necessary Phazon to operate.
Special Abilities: High range, high power, high speed, high accuracy, requires Phazon.


Suits.




1. Varia Suit.
- This is the suit that you start with at the beginning of the game. The Varia suit allows the user to survive in some demanding conditions, but not all. One of the most beneficial uses for the suit, however, is the ability to breath without any oxygen present. This means Samus can freely travel on moons and throughout space without needing air to survive and breathe. It is also insulated and outfitted with a body temperature regulator. It stands up to most conventional environments, but is not outfitted with the proper modules to maintain proper temperature in sub-zero temperatures or super-heated areas. As an addon the Power Suit, it grants greatly improved protection against enemy attacks. Finally, it is used as the base suit for new suits to add their technology and aesthetics to.
Special Abilities: (None).

2. Gravity Suit.
- The Gravity Suit is a slight upgrade from the Varia Suit, depending on what your preferences are in terms of mobility and damage resistance. The new suit allows the wearer to traverse the most demanding of environments, from sub-zero to super-heated. Also, the suit allows free movement in water and much greater resistance to acid. Finally, the Gravity suit allows for improved mobility and speed at a moderate cost to defense.
Special Abilities: Free liquid movement, temperature resistance, increased speed, acid traversal.

3. Phazon Suit.
- The Phazon Suit is very powerful. Combining the versatility of the Varia Suit, the speed of the Gravity Suit, defense, and increased weapon power. The natural aura of Phazon slightly amplifies the damaging effects of your weaponry. Also allows for traversal over Blue Phazon.
Special Abilities: Blue Phazon traversal, increased defense, increased power.

4. Corruption Suit.
- Not to be confused with the Galactic Federation's P.E.D. (Phazon Enhancement Device) Suit, the Corruption Suit is unmatched in every aspect. Allows the traversal of any environment, including acid, lava, abnormal temperatures, Blue and Orange Phazon, and Ingstorm. Also allows free movement in any liquid, grants supernatural speed, power, and defense, and requires Blue Phazon to operate. The requirement of local Phazon does not even come close to balancing with the abilities it grants the wearer.
Special Abilites: Immunity to environmental hazards, supernatural speed, supernatural power, supernatural defense, allows Hypermode which requires Phazon.


Addons.



1. Morph Ball.
- Possibly the most recognizable item in Samus' arsenal, the Morph Ball was created by the Chozo, allowing users of a Power Suit to transform into a small sphere, less than a meter in diameter. Over time, other races took the technology and improved upon it, making the Morph Ball smaller, faster, and more versatile. Exactly how it functions is a mystery that died with the Chozo race, but it still represents a vital part of universal technological progress.
Special Abilities: Increased speed, reduced size.

2. Morph Ball Bomb.
- Always used in conjunction with the Morph Ball, the Ball Bomb implementation allows Samus to lay small, concussive objects that detonate after a few seconds. They are able to destroy orange Brinstone blocks and when used in conjunction with the Morph Ball, are used to kill massive targets from the inside and activate switches.
Special Abilities: Destroy Brinstone, defeat large enemies via weak points.

3. Power Bomb.
- The Power Bomb is the "big brother" of the Ball Bomb, and even that is an understatement. The explosion it creates is absolutely massive, deals a ton of damage to enemies that are vulnerable to neutron explosions, and can destroy obstructions composed of Denzium. Like the Super Missile, it is heavily hindered by its requirement of rare ammunition.
Special Abilities: Destroy Bendezium, large explosion, high power.

4. Screw Bomb.
- The Screw Bomb is the grandaddy of all bombs. Having a slightly smaller range than its predecessor, the Power Bomb, it packs a significantly larger punch. The Screw Bomb has a brief timer before exploding and annihilating anything close by. Besides that, it bounces electric nodes all over the area, zapping anything in their path. Considered one of the most devastating weapons in Samus' arsenal, it does not come without a grave limitation; it costs 2 Power Bombs to use.
Special Abilities: Destroy Quartzinium, large explosion, high power.

5. Speed Booster.
- The Speed Booster is just that - a speed booster. After running for a short period of time in a straight line, the user generates an inhuman burst of speed, allowing them to annihilate almost anything in their path, and bash straight through Bendezium obstructions.
Special Abilities: Destroy Zebesian Colossus Alloy (ZCA), supernatural speed.

6. Jet Boost.
- The Jet Boost is a unique item. It allows Samus to fire blasts of air out of the vents in the back of her suit in such a way that she defies the laws of physics, granting her incredible agility for a fraction of a second. This allows her to quickly dodge incoming attacks, especially from fast enemies.
Special Abilities: Superior agility, dodging.

7. Lightsear.
- The Lightsear is a brand new defensive utility, created in a joint project with the Chozo and Luminoth years ago, but hidden away on a remote, life-bearing planet. The Lightsear allows the user to activate it for a split second, reflecting most projectiles back at enemies with increased speed and power.
Special Ability: Projectile reflection.


Secondary Weapons.



1. Missile.
- A classic weapon in Samus' arsenal, the missile exhibits superior power and accuracy, and nearly unlimited range. However, it is heavily limited by its requirement of ammunition.
Special Ability: Destroy Talloric Alloy.

2. Super Missile.
- The Super Missile is superior to the regular Missiles in every way. The projectile moves faster and is three times as volatile, but ammunition for this weapon is extremely scarce. While very powerful, the Super Missile should be used very sparingly.
Special Abilities: Destroy Cordite, destroy Talloric Alloy, shake area.

3. Homing Missile.
- Samus' versatile Combat Visor allows her to control these missiles by creating a digital picture of the surrounding area and laying it out on her interface. The slow speed allowing for great control and near-limitless range are balanced by the fact that it requires three regular Missiles to fire. Use sparingly.
Special Abilities: Destroy Bendezium, destroy Talloric Alloy, guided targeting.

4. Diffusion Missile.
- The Diffusion Missile is widely feared amongst Samus' enemies. The impact of this missile creates a powerful explosion and also releases a massive burst of ice. Anything caught in the blast or by the ice particles is snap-frozen. Note that this uses two already-hard-to-find Super Missiles. This should be used only against the most powerful of enemies.
Special Abilities: Destroy Maldite, destroy Cordite, destroy Talloric Alloy, freeze enemies in a large area, high power, shake area.

5. Diffuser.
- Another unique addon to Samus' arm cannon, the Diffuser supercharges Samus' Charge Beam. When charged projectiles make impact, the explosion is much greater, damaging all nearby enemies for small amounts of damage.
Special Abilities: Charged beam diffusal.


Visors.



1. Combat Visor.
- This is Samus' basic visor. Outfitted with a fully detailed H.U.D. (Heads-up display), hazard meters, a targeting system, and energy displays, this is half of what allows Samus to perform her incredible feats.

2. Scan Visor.
- Crucial to most of Samus' missions, the Scan Visor allows her to easily gather information on local surroundings, record lore to her Logbook, and help to understand what to do next.
Special Ability: Allows Samus to interface with environment and HUD.

3. X-ray Visor.
- The X-ray Visor is rather self-explanatory and extremely useful. It allows Samus to spot weakpoints on tough enemies and reveals secrets when she is close.
Special Ability: Allows Samus to detect weakpoints and secrets when enabled.


Expansions.



1. Energy Tank.
- Adds 100 to Samus' Energy capacity.

2. Accel Tank.
- Increases how quickly Samus can charge her beams, inreases how quickly Morph Ball Bombs detonate, increases the cooling rate of the Plasma Beam, and speeds up other Power Suit processes by a small amount.

3. Missile Expansion.
- Increases Missile capacity by 5.

4. Super Missile Expansion.
- Increases Super Missile capacity by 2.

5. Power Bomb Expansion.
- Increases Power Bomb capacity by 1.


Removed Items.
Note: As the above subtitle states, the following items have been removed and are no longer in the game.


 
1. Grapple Beam.
- The Grapple beam is another classic weapon in Samus' arsenal. With it, she can link up to potential grapple points and pull herself across otherwise-inaccessible gaps. While the clutching ability of the beam does not allow the user to deal any damage, it can be used to tear armor off of heavy enemies.
Special Abilities: Traverse gaps, pull in items, tear armor off targets.

2. Dark Suit.
- This suit is the first dramatic departure from the typical look of Samus' suits. The Dark Suit was created by the Luminoth, friends of the legendary Chozo to protect their warriors from the hazardous effects of Dark Aether's atmosphere. While very prototypical, the Dark Suit provides insane protection at a great reduction in speed, likening it to a snail's pace. The protection you get is unmatched even by the most advanced technology. Also grants a small increase to weapon power.
Special Abilities: Impenetrable defense, reduced speed.

3. Light Suit.
- The Light Suit is the ultimate blending of Luminoth and Chozo technology, yielding the effects of darkness totally harmless. Allows for the utmost superior speed, the same defense as the Dark Suit, vastly improved firepower, and allows the wearer to move through corrosive Ingstorm.
Special Abilities: High power, high speed, high defense, Ingstorm traversal.
